With its long legs and neck, the Masai giraffe is the world’s tallest land mammal. The giraffe has a huge heart—think of a 25 pound basketball—which generates the high blood pressure necessary to maintain blood flow up to its brain. Species: crocuta. Spotted hyenas are known for their distinctive vocalizations used for communication, earning them the nickname, "laughing" hyenas. Vocalizations include cackles, howls, yells, whoops and other sounds which are inaudible to humans. Whoops are used to gather or alert clan members, while the laugh or giggle is ...Wattled Crane. Genus: Tyto. Species: alba. Barn owls are found on all continents except Antarctica. These birds of prey have distinct adaptations that make them successful nocturnal hunters. Their eyes are large to allow light in and, unlike human eyes, can't move inside of the eye socket. Owls instead turn their heads up to 270 degrees. Franklin Park Zoo is a 72-acre site nestled in Boston’s historic Franklin Park, long considered the "crown jewel" of Frederick Law Olmsted’s Emerald Necklace Park System. The Zoo was founded in 1912 and was managed by the City of Boston until 1958, when the Metropolitan District Commission (MDC), a …Party at ZNE. • At Stone Zoo, birthday parties are held from mid-April to mid-September in a 30x40 tent. • At Franklin Park Zoo, birthday parties can be held in a tented venue or indoor space between May 1 and October 30. Visitors can expect a well-maintained and professionally run ... Species: tridactyla. The giant anteater has small eyes and ears, a long snout, and a bushy tail. It's typically brown with white and black stripes. Its tongue can elongate to approximately 2 feet in order to capture prey. The giant anteater is not aggressive, but when cornered it will defend itself with the 4-inch claws of its forepaws. Heritage Chicken must have the genetic ability to live a long, vigorous life and thrive in the rigors of pasture-based, outdoor production systems. Breeding hens should be productive for 5-7 years and roosters for 3-5 years. Slow growth rate. Genus: Ephippiorhynchus. Species: senegalensis. Saddle-billed storks have a striking black and white plumage, accented by a bright red bill. Female saddle-bills have pale yellow eyes, while males have darker irises. Kiwis are small, flightless and nearly wingless birds. They're the smallest of the ratites, a distinct group of large, flightless birds. Kiwis vocalize by hissing, growling and grunting. To find one another in the dark as well as to defend their territories, kiwis can shriek loudly. This cry sounds like “kee-wee, kee-wee ... Two subspecies at Franklin Park Zoo: Ailurus fulgens fulgens. Ailurus fulgens refulgens (styani) The red panda resembles a raccoon because of its ringed tail and mask-like face. It's named for the soft, dense red fur that covers even the soles of its feet, keeping it warm in the forests of its Himalayan habitat. .
